How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Newton?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Newton Studio Apartments | $646 | $525 | $722 |
| Newton 1 Bedroom Apartments | $987 | $625 | $1,555 |
| Newton 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,198 | $699 | $1,661 |
| Newton 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,356 | $758 | $1,842 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Pet Friendly Newton Apartments
What is the Cheapest Pet Friendly apartment in Newton?
Currently the most affordable Pet Friendly Apartment in Newton is at Amidon Place Apartments listed at $525.
How much is the average rent for a Pet Friendly Newton Apartment?
The average rent for a Pet Friendly Apartment in Newton is $1,152.
What is the largest Pet Friendly Newton Apartment for rent?
Today's Pet Friendly apartment with the most square footage in Newton is a 2,011 square feet unit starting from $700 at 21W Apartments.
What is the average size for Newton Pet Friendly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Pet Friendly rental in Newton is currently at 696 sq ft.
